§ 13203. — 13203. (Amended by Stats. 2021, Ch. 158, Sec. 2.)
California·Code PEN Penal Code - PEN·Title 3.·Part 4. TITLE 3. CRIMINAL STATISTICS·Ch. 2. CHAPTER 2. Criminal Offender Record Information·Art. 5. ARTICLE 5. Access to Information
(a)A criminal justice agency may release, within five years of the arrest, information concerning an arrest or detention of a peace officer, as defined in Section 830, an applicant for a position as a peace officer, a nonsworn employee of a criminal justice agency, or an applicant for a nonsworn position within a criminal justice agency that did not result in conviction, and for which the person did not complete a postarrest diversion program, to a governmental agency employer of that employee or applicant.
